Men's Basketball to Play Exhibition at Rider on Saturday
SELINSGROVE, Pa. – The Susquehanna University men's basketball team will be in action this Saturday as the Crusaders travel to Division I Rider for an exhibition game that tips off at 3 p.m. at Alumni Gymnasium in Lawrenceville, N.J. Rider, a member of the Metro Atlantic Athletic Conference, is coached by former Crusader standout and 1986 graduate Don Harnum , son and namesake of Susquehanna's former head coach and director of athletics, who will be entering his eighth season as head coach of the Broncs with a 108-93 career record. In addition, former Susquehanna player and assistant coach and 1997 graduate Tommy Dempsey is beginning his second season as an assistant at Rider after coaching at Lackawanna and Keystone Colleges. Susquehanna head coach Frank Marcinek was an assistant to the elder Harnum during his son's career with the Crusaders, and served as head coach during Dempsey's playing and coaching tenure at Susquehanna. He will begin his 16 th season with a 216-161 career record. The Crusaders finished 15-9 overall and in fifth place in the Commonwealth Conference with a 7-7 league mark, while the Broncs went 17-14 and took fifth in the MAAC with a 10-8 conference record. Susquehanna opens its 2004-05 regular season on Friday, Nov. 19 at 8 p.m. against Elmira in the Pepsi/Weis Markets Tip-Off Tournament at O.W. Houts Gymnasium.
